My coffee breaks lead to a few more observations.
The portraits, which are hung high on the walls, have a wider edge above than below.
The angle cuts out any reflections that could prevent you from contemplating the Sun of 21th century and his venerable father. It also intensifies the gaze in this face-to-face encounter. <...>
Both wear one of the official badges that invariably depict Kim Junior or Kim Senior. You can't tell from the portraits, but it's tempting to think they're wearing each other's images, creating the kind of short circuit animators love...
